    Everton Fox is a British weather presenter, currently working for Al Jazeera English and is notable for being the first ever black weather-presenter to appear on the BBC. Career. Fox worked for the then Department of Social Security as a civil servant and in 1991 joined the Met Office, completing the forecaster foundation programme in March 2000.

    The Big Weekend Show (also The Big Saturday Show and The Big Sunday Show from 2021 to 2023) is an American panel talk show on Fox News in which four rotating Fox News personalities discuss current stories, political issues, and pop culture. The program airs live every Saturday and Sunday at 7 p.m. ET. [1]

    Stephen Morgan is a meteorologist and host for Fox Weather. He leads coverage for the streaming service’s main weekday hours. Morgan is based in New York City, coming from his previous position as meteorologist at KRIV-TV in Houston. [1] [2] He moved to the East Coast with his husband Steven Romo in 2021.
